How much do server position j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 7, 2026, the average hourly pay for server position in Springfield, OH is $13.77,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$9.33 and $15.58 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a server position?

Server positions refer to jobs in the hospitality industry where individuals are responsible for taking orders, serving food and beverages, and ensuring a positive dining experience for guests at restaurants or similar establishments. Servers often greet customers, answer questions about the menu, handle payments, and coordinate with kitchen staff to fulfill orders efficiently. This role requires strong communication sk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work in a fast-paced environment. Many servers also rely on tips as a significant part of their income, making customer service skills especially important.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a server?

To thrive as a Server, you need strong customer service skills, attention to detail, and basic math abilities, typically with a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ems and food safety certifications are commonly required. Excellent communication, teamwork, and the ability to stay calm under pressure help Servers provide outstanding guest experiences. These skills ensure efficient service, satisfied customers, and smooth restaurant operations.

What are some common challenges that servers face during busy shifts, and how can they effectively manage them?

Servers often encounter challenges such as handling multiple tables at once, managing special requests, and maintaining a positive attitude during peak hours. Effective time management, clear communication with kitchen staff and teammates, and keeping organized with orders are key to success. It also helps to stay calm under pressure and anticipate guests' needs to provide excellent service. Many restaurants offer support through team-based approaches and regular briefings to help servers navigate busy periods.

Job description

Server Wait Staff

StoryPoint Troy

Position Summary: Part-Time, 8am-2pm and 4pm-8pm

As a Server, you will perform a variety of food service functions and maintain clean and sanitary conditions of service area, facilities and equipment. You will take on a rewarding position with an innovative company where hard work pays off and advancement is always a possibility.

Required Experience for Server:

  • Prior restaurant experience is preferred but not required.
  • Must be friendly, provide excellent customer service and consistently display an attitude, which fosters a teamwork environment.

Primary Responsibilities for Server:

  • Serve meals in a professional manner, demonstrating a genuine concern to please residents and guests.
  • Follow safe food handling and sanitation practices.
  • Perform all side work and setup/breakdown duties as assigned.
  • Ensure that residents and guests receive high quality food in a timely fashion.
  • Maintain a positive attitude, demonstrate professional behavior, and practice good personal hygiene.
  • Wait on tables and assist other staff as needed.
  • Tactfully and professionally, handle resident concerns and complaints.
  • Follow all Dining Services Standards of service.

General Working Conditions:

This position entails standing for long periods of time. While performing the duties of this job, the employee is required to communicate effectively with others, sit, stand, walk and use hands to handle keyboard, telephone, paper, files, and other equipment and objects. The employee is occasionally required to reach with hands and arms. This position requires employee to effectively present information in one-on-one a small group situation with residents, guests, and other associates. This position requires the ability to review detailed documents and read computer screens. The employee will occasionally lift and/or move up to 25 pounds. The work environment requires appropriate interaction with others. Employee must be able to read, write, and speak fluent English. The noise level in the work environment is moderate.
